Transaction 21adaecfaeead78c896617286f8bcceb5677eb722d9c92813f8debd65785085b

1 Input
2 Outputs
  • 21adaecfaeead78c896617286f8bcceb5677eb722d9c92813f8debd65785085b:0
  • value  350800
    address  3G58cpddFVbU7JrLnsSY13EkUmCZJzVuF3
  • 21adaecfaeead78c896617286f8bcceb5677eb722d9c92813f8debd65785085b:1
  • value  1837222
    address  1FbDh2PJgmrFYVwjTSMM8qhixiZeTfS93f